77范文网 - 专业文章范例文档资料分享平台

JSP笔试题及答案

来源:网络收集 时间:2019-01-05 下载这篇文档 手机版
说明:文章内容仅供预览,部分内容可能不全,需要完整文档或者需要复制内容,请下载word后使用。下载word有问题请添加微信号:或QQ: 处理(尽可能给您提供完整文档),感谢您的支持与谅解。点击这里给我发消息

1、JSP 页面由JSP页面元素构成,以下JSP页面元素属于JSP指令的是(A ). (选择一项) A. <%@page language=\isErrorPage=\ B. <%!String getHello(String name){return \ C. <%java.util.Date now=new java.util.Date(); out.println(\当前时间是:\ D. <%=new java.util.Date()%>

2、在Java中,欲成功更新表course中数据(hours 字段为int型,coursethitle为nvarchar型),假设已经获得了数据库连接,Connection的对象con,则在以下程序段的下划线处应该填写的代码是(B ).

PreparedStatement

pstmt=con.prepareStatement(\

course

set

hours=?where

coursetitle=?\ ___________________________//此处填写代码

pstmt.setString(2,\pstmt.executeUpdate(); A. pstmt.setInt(2,800); B. pstmt.setInt(1,800);

C. pstmt.setString(2,\ D. pstmt.setString(1,\

3、基于Java技术的Web应用程序目录结构中,WEB-INF目录位于文档根目录下, WEB-INF目录的组成部分不包括(AB)。 (选择二项)

a) JSP文件

b) src目录 c) lib目录

d) web.xml

4、给定JSP 代码如下所示,则该JSP 的运行结果是(A) (选择一项) <%!

Public static void func(int num){ ++num;

} %> <%

int num=9; func(num);

out.println(num++); %>

a) 显示 “9”

b) c)

显示 “10” 显示 “11”

d) JSP编译错误

5、以下选项中,描述Web容嚣处理JSP文件请求三个阶段的先后顺序正确的是(B).

a) 编译阶段、翻译阶段、执行阶段 b) 翻译阶段、编译阶段、执行阶段 c) 执行阶段、翻译阶段、编译阶段

d) 执行阶段、编译阶段、翻译阶段

6、在JSP页面中,JSP晓脚本如下所示,则要取出session中的值,下划线处的代码不可以是()。(选择1项) <%

String str=\session.setAttrbute(\-----------------------------

%>

a) String s=session.getParameter(\b) String s=(String)session.getAttribute(\c) Object o=session.getAttribute(\

d) Object o=(String)session.getAttribut(\

7、在Java中开发JDBC应用程序时,使用DriverManager类的getConnection()方法建立

与数据源连接的语句为: Connection con = DriverManager.getConnection(“jdbc:obdc:test”); URL链接中的“test”表示的是(C)。 (选择一项) a) 数据库中表的名称

b) 数据库中服务器的机器名 c) 数据源的名称 d) 用户名

8、在JSP页面中,下列(A)表达式语句可以获取页面请求中名字为title的文本框的内容。

(选择一项) a) <%=request.getParameter(“title”)%> b) <%=request.getAttribute(“title”)%>

c) <%=request.getParameterValues(“title”)%>

d) <%=request.getParameters(“title”)%>

9、在用户登陆的JSP页面上,包含如下代码所示的表单,用户希望提交表单时在地址栏上不显示提交信息,则应该在下划线处填写的代码是(B)。(选择一项) a) get

b) post

c) 不填写任何内容 d) 以上选项均可

10、基于Java技术的Web应用程序打包时,要求按特定的目录机构组织文件,此目录结

构中包含一个wed-inf目录,一般情况下,该目录中包含以下各组成部分,除了

(AC)。(选择二项)

a) src目录 b) web.xml文件

c) Java源文件 d) lib目录

11、给定JSP代码如下所示,在横线处编写()语句,可以使得程序运行后该页面输出的结果是1。(选择一项) D

<%int count = 1;%> _______________

a) <%=++count%> b) <%++count;%> c) <%count++;%> d) <%=count++%>

12、在JSP中,要在page指令中设置使用的脚本语言是Java,且导入了java.io和java.util

包,下列语句中正确的是()。(选择二项) A,D a) <%@ page language=”java” import=”java.io.*,java.util.*”%> b) <%@ page language=”java” import=”java.io,java.util.*”%> c) <%@ page language=”java” import=”java.io”import=”java.util”%> d) <%@ page language=”java”%>

<%@ page import=”java.io.*,java.util.*”%>

13、在Web应用程序中,编写了公共的处理页面名为manage.jsp,该页面包含在web根目

录下名为util的文件夹中,那么在Web根目录下的其他页面上引用该页面的代码正确

的是()。(选择一项) B a) <%include file = “util/manage.jsp”%>

b) <%@ include file = “util/manage.jsp”%> c) <%! include file = “util/manage.jsp”%> d)

14、在Java语言中,已知con为已经建立的数据库连接对象,则下列()是正确的JDBC

代码片段。(选择二项) a)

PreparedStatement

pstmt=con.prepareStatement(“insert

into

EMP(EMPNO,ENAME)values(?,?)”); pstmt.setInt(1,7);

pstmt.setString(2,”Admin”); b)

PreparedStatement pstmt=con.prepareStatement(“insert EMP(EMPNO,ENAME)values(?,?)”);

into

pstmt.setInt(1,”7”);

pstmt.setString(2,”Admin”);

c) d)

Statement

stmt

=

con.createStatement(“insert

into into

EMP(EMPNO,ENAME)values(7,’Adimin’)”);

PreparedStatement stmtl=con.prepareStatement(“insert EMP(EMPNO,ENAME)values(7,’Admin’)”);

15、JSP页面也包括如下代码,则 访问此JSP页面时将输出(B)。

<%=2+3%> a) 2+3 b) 5 c) 23

d) 不会输出,因为表达式是错误的

16、在JDBC 应用程序中,使用Statement接口的( D )办法,执行查询语句,并可返回结果集。 a) execute() b) close()

c) executeUpdate() d) executeQuery()

17、在使用JSP开发的Web应用程序中,home目录与images目录为同级目录,现在要在home目录下的index.jsp中访问images目录下的图片1.jpg,以下片段正确的是( A )。

a) b)

c)

d) 18、编写JSP小脚本,实现访问该JSP时,在会话对象中保存int型变量i的有效语句是()。

a)

b)

session.setAttribute(i,”I”); session.setParameter(“I”,i);

c) session.setAttribute(new Intrger(i),”I”); d) session,setAttribute(“I”,new Integer(i));

19、有如下JSP代码,为了获取session中存储的用户名,请问在下划线处应插入以下(D)代码。

session示例

<%session.setAttribute(“username”,”lemon”);%> <%_________%> a) b) c)

String name = session.getParameter(“username”); String name = session.getAttribute(“username”);

String name = (String)session.getParameter(“username”);

d) String name = (String)session.getAttribute(“username”); 20、JSP文件test.jsp文件如下所示,运行时,将发生()。 <%

Java.lang.StringBuffer buffer=null; buffer.append(“ABC”); %>

buffer is<%=buffer%> a) b)

编译期错误

编译Java源代码时错误

c) 执行编译后的字节码时发生错误

d) 运行后,浏览器上显示:buffer is ABC

21、在JavaJDBC编程中,下列语句能够正确加载JDBC-ODBC桥驱动程序的是()。(选

择一项) C

A DriverManager.forName(“sun.jdbc.odbc.jdbcOdbcDriver”); B DriverManager.getConnection(“sun.jdbc.odbc.JdbcOdbcDriver”) C Class.forName(“sun.jdbc.odbc.jdbcOdbcDriver”)

D Class.getConnection(“sun.jdbc.odbc.jdbcOdbcdriver”) 22、在使用

JSP开发web项目时,图片文件一般位于目录结构中的()

下。(选择一项) B A src目录

B 文档根目录或其子文件夹 C META-INF目录 D WEB-INF目录

23、给定JSP程序源代码如下所示,则该JSP运行后输出的结果是()(选择一项)

<%count =1; %> count;<%=++count%> A count:1 B count:2 C 1:2 D count; 24、在

JSP页面执行过程的()阶段,JSP页面被web容器转换为Java

源代码(选择一项) A A 翻译 B 编译 C 执行 D 响应请求

25、在用户登录的JSP页面上,包含如下代码所示的表单,当用户填写信息后点击“登录”按钮是,将产生的结果是()(选择一项) A

用户名:
密码: < input type=”submit”value=”登录”/>

百度搜索“77cn”或“免费范文网”即可找到本站免费阅读全部范文。收藏本站方便下次阅读,免费范文网,提供经典小说综合文库JSP笔试题及答案在线全文阅读。

JSP笔试题及答案.doc 将本文的Word文档下载到电脑,方便复制、编辑、收藏和打印 下载失败或者文档不完整,请联系客服人员解决!
本文链接:https://www.77cn.com.cn/wenku/zonghe/405169.html(转载请注明文章来源)
Copyright © 2008-2022 免费范文网 版权所有
声明 :本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。
客服QQ: 邮箱:tiandhx2@hotmail.com
苏ICP备16052595号-18
× 注册会员免费下载(下载后可以自由复制和排版)
注册会员下载
全站内容免费自由复制
注册会员下载
全站内容免费自由复制
注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: